Polyvinylidene Fluoride (PVDF) coatings are a commonly used commercial and industrial coating. PVDF is a fluoropolymer resin that is highly inert and stable, providing excellent resistance from metal weathering over time. PVDF coatings are a resin-based coating system. finish properties
finish property | unit of measure | value | test standard |
---|---|---|---|
nominal organic top coating thickness | µm (microns) | 25 | EN 13523-1 |
specular gloss (60°) | % | 15-40 | EN 13523-2 |
scratch resistance | g | 2000 | EN 13523-12 |
abrasion resitance (taber, 250 rev, 1kg, CS10 wheels) | mg | <30 | EN 13523-16 |
flexibility: minimum bend radius | T | 2T | EN 13523-7 |
adhesion | T | ≤ 1T | EN 13523-7 |
corrosion resistance: | |||
salt spray | hours | 500 | EN 13523-8 |
humidity | hours | 1000 | EN 13523-26 |
corrosion resistance category | RC3* | EN 10169 | |
UV resistance category | Ruv4 | EN 10169 | |
reaction to fire classification** | A1 | EN 13501-1 |
The figures contained in the above table are typical properties and do not constitute a specification.
* To meet the corrosion resistance properties a zinc weight of Z275g/m² or MagiZinc® ZMA140g/m² applies.
** Fire classification is subject to gauge. Non standard double sided material is not tested and as such quoted fire classification may not be applicable.
